Glucoseverwertung und Dynamik der Insulinsekretion Messungen nach intraabdominellen Operationen

Glucose-assimilation and dynamics of insulin secretion. Measurements after intra-abdominal operations

Summary

Insulin concentrations in peripheral venous blood and portal venous blood were measured in 18 patients after intraabdominal operations during 20 standardised glucose-infusion-tests (GIT). The conclusion is as follows:

  1. 1.

    In spite of similar preoperative situations and operative traumatisation the islets reactivity to a constant hyperglycemia and the glucose assimilation is individually very different.

  2. 2.

    Measurements of insulin concentrations in the portal venous blood in man show a significant correlation between the profile of the insulin concentration curve and thek-value; the measurement of the insulin concentrations in peripheral venous blood fails to demonstrate a significant difference.

  3. 3.

    In patients with a pathologic glucose assimilation it is not the insulin secretion that is delayed but the insulin regression (disappearance rate) in portal venous blood.

  4. 4.

    In patients with a normal glucose assimilation the insulin concentration curve in portal venous blood shows an oscillating course during the first 30 min. These oscillations registered for the first time in humans indicate an insulin-induced feedback mechanism of insulin secretion.

Zusammenfassung

Die Insulinkonzentrationen im peripheren Venenblut und Pfortaderblut wurden während 20 standardisierter Glucoseinfusionstests bei 18 Patienten nach intraabdominellen Operationen gemessen. Folgende Schlußfolgerungen werden gezogen:

  1. 1.

    Trotz vergleichbarer präoperativer Ausgangssituation und Traumatisierung durch die Operation ist die Reaktivität des Inselzellapparates auf eine konstante Hyperglykämie und entsprechend die Glucoseverwertung individuell sehr verschieden.

  2. 2.

    Die Messungen der Insulinkonzentration im Pfortaderblut des Menschen ergeben eine signifikante Korrelation zwischen dem Profil der Insulinkonzentrationskurve und demk-Wert; die Meßergebnisse der Insulinkonzentration im peripher-venösen Blut zeigen trotz großerk-Wert-Unterschiede keine eindeutigen Beziehungen.

  3. 3.

    Bei den Patienten mit einer pathologischen Glucoseverwertung ist weniger die Geschwindigkeit der Insulinsekretion als die der Insulinregression aus dem Pfortaderblut verzögert.

  4. 4.

    Bei den Patienten mit einer normalen Glucoseverwertung zeigt die Insulinkonzentrationskurve im Pfortaderblut in den ersten 30 min einen oscillierenden Verlauf. Diese erstmals beim Menschen beobachteten Oscillationen weisen auf eine insulingesteuerte Rückkoppelung der Insulinsekretion hin.
